Hvac System Installation in Annapolis, MD
HVAC system installation services involve setting up new he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ems in residential properties. These projects typically include installing central air units, furnaces, heat pumps, or ductwork to ensure proper climate control throughout a home. Property owners often seek this service when building a new house, replacing outdated equipment, or upgrading to a more efficient system to improve comfort and energy performance. It’s important for homeowners to understand the size and layout of the property, the compatibility of new equipment with existing infrastructure, and any specific preferences for energy efficiency or indoor air quality before requesting installation services.
Before requesting HVAC installation, property owners should consider the size of the space needing climate control, as well as any existing ductwork or electrical systems that may influence the project scope. Understanding the different types of systems available, such as ducted or ductless options, can help determine the best solution for a home’s layout and budget. Additionally, knowing the desired level of energy efficiency, indoor air quality features, and any local building codes or regulations can ensure the installation process proceeds smoothly and meets all necessary requirements.

Common Hvac System Installation Jobs
Central HVAC System Installation - provides whole-home heating and cooling for consistent comfort.
Ductless Mini-Split Systems - offers flexible cooling and heating options for specific rooms or zones.
Heat Pump Installation - delivers efficient climate control by combining heating and cooling in one unit.
Furnace Replacement - upgrades outdated heating systems to improve energy efficiency and reliability.
Air Handler and Ventilation System Setup - enhances indoor air quality and airflow throughout the property.

Hvac System Installation Questions
What types of HVAC systems can be installed? Various options include central air conditioners, ductless mini-splits, and heat pumps to suit different property needs.
How do I know if a new HVAC system is needed? Signs include inconsistent temperatures, increased energy bills, or frequent system breakdowns.
What factors influence the choice of a new HVAC system? Property size, existing ductwork, and specific comfort requirements are key considerations.
What should property owners consider before installation? Proper sizing, system compatibility, and ensuring adequate ventilation are important for optimal performance.
